Good to know

  • Rental age requirements generally aren't a one-size-fits-all. Companies can set their own policies, and if you're under the minimum age, you could encounter extra costs or restrictions. Check what rules apply with each supplier before booking your rental in Canada.

  • If you're travelling with kids, find out if you need to add a child car seat to your Gatineau car hire booking. Whether local laws require them or not, they're always the safest way for youngsters to travel.

  • You'll need to bring a few things when picking up your rental car: your physical driver's licence, another form of photo ID, and a credit card with enough funds for the security deposit. Debit cards aren't widely accepted. Your booking will show the full list of what's required.

  • Driving in Canada might take some adjustment for first-time visitors. Keep in mind you'll need to stay on the right side of the road.

  • Stay within the local speed limits. Usually that's around 45kph in urban areas and 95kph or so on highways, unless signed otherwise.

  • In Canada, the legal blood alcohol concentration (BAC) limit is 0.08%. If you intend to drink, pass the keys to someone else or find an alternative way to get around.
